Westphal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

(German) One who came from Westphalen (western plain), in Germany.

Dictionary of American Family Names (1956) by Elsdon Coles Smith

A native of Westphalia, in Germany.

Patronymica Britannica (1860) by Mark Antony Lower

How Common Is The Last Name Westphal?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 11,483rd most frequent last name in the world It is held by approximately 1 in 148,859 people. This surname is predominantly found in Europe, where 70 percent of Westphal reside; 68 percent reside in Western Europe and 67 percent reside in Germanic Europe. Westphal is also the 2,301,746th most numerous first name worldwide It is held by 22 people.

The last name Westphal is most commonly held in Germany, where it is held by 32,015 people, or 1 in 2,515. In Germany it is most numerous in: Schleswig-Holstein, where 18 percent live, North Rhine-Westphalia, where 14 percent live and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, where 14 percent live. Not including Germany this surname occurs in 62 countries. It also occurs in The United States, where 20 percent live and Brazil, where 8 percent live.

Westphal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Westphal has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Westphal surname expanded 1,191 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it expanded 714 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Scotland it contracted 75 percent between 1881 and 2014.
